Python has grown in popularity over the years to become one of the most popular programming languages for machine learning (ML) and artificial intelligence (AI) tasks. It has replaced many of the existing languages in the industry, and it is more efficient when compared to these mainstream programming languages. On top of all of that, its English-like commands make it accessible to beginners and experts alike.
Another fundamental feature of Python that draws many of its users is its vast collection of open-source libraries. These libraries can be used by programmers of all experience levels for tasks involving ML and AI, data science, image and data manipulation, and much more.
Python’s open-source libraries are not the only feature that make it favorable for machine learning and AI tasks. Python is also highly versatile and flexible, meaning it can also be used alongside other programming languages when needed. Even further, it can operate on nearly all OS and platforms on the market.
Implementing deep neural networks and machine learning algorithms can be extremely time consuming, but Python offers many packages that cut down on this. It is also an object-oriented programming (OOP) language, which makes it extremely useful for efficient data use and categorization.
Another factor that makes Python favorable, especially to beginners, is its growing community of users. Since it is one of the fastest growing programming languages in the world, the number of Python developers and development services has exploded. The Python community is growing alongside the language, with active members always looking to use it to tackle new problems in business.
